Government technology market veterans Matt Warren and John Harllee have been named co-chief operating officers of information technology and management consulting services provider Strategic Enterprise Solutions.
Warren will oversee the McLean, Va.-based companys emerging markets sector and Harllee will manage overall corporate operations as well as growth efforts under the established accounts sector, SE Solutions said Monday.
Warren brings more than 24 years of technology sales experience, primarily within the departments of Commerce, Education, Energy, Homeland Security, Justice and State to his new role.
Harllee’s 24-year industry career has included leadership roles at Oracle (NYSE: ORCL) and Accentures (NYSE: ACN) federal services arm.
In the same announcement, SE Solutions said Kate Abrey, a 15-year federal technology program management professional, will serve as executive vice president and general manager of the company’s emerging markets segment and be responsible for the development and delivery of new offerings.
